Skeletal Remains Found By Youtuber In Abandoned Milwaukee Church
Investigators are hoping to identify a body discovered in an abandoned building near Burleigh Street and MLK Drive on Aug. 10.

MILWAUKEE, WI — A partially skeletonized body was discovered in an abandoned building in Milwaukee recently and authorites are looking to the public for help in bringing an identity to the man.
A Youtuber found the body on Aug. 10 on the second floor of a long-abandoned building that formerly housed a church near Burleigh Street and Martin Luther King Jr. Drive, according to the Milwaukee County Medical Examiner's Office narrative report. Authorites have been trying to identify the body since it was discovered, and on Thursday, the medical examiner's office took to Twitter with photos of rings found with the man.

Courtesy Milwaukee County Medical Examiner's Office. Rings found with an unidentified body discovered in August in Milwaukee.

The man was found also wearing an American CIE brand large dark coat with an orange lining, a white shirt with a Pfizer logo and "screen for health," black pants and five rings, the medical examiner's office said.
Authorites asked anyone with information to call Milwaukee police at 414-935-7360 or the medical examiner's office at 414-223-1200.

An official from the medical examiner's office visited the scene shortly after the Youtuber reported the death to police, according to the agency's report. The building's plaster walls and ceilings were crumbling, garbage was strewn about, including clothing, lighters, food wrappers and drink containers, while one room was filled with old school desks, the report said.
The man was wearing multiple layers of clothing, the report said, including athletic pants and long underwear. Parts of the body were mostly mummified, and the back of his jacket was torn, but no underlying injury to the body or bones was immediately observed, according to the medical examiner's office. Authorites have not been able to find family of the man.
The man who found the body gave a cell phone he found to police, but police confirmed the phone's owner is still alive, according to the medical examiner. It was unknown where the man found the phone.
The medical examiner's office has multiple other open cases of unidentified people found dead in Milwaukee dating back to the 1970s.
